Study Summary

Subjects who completed either D5180C00007 or D5180C00009 will be offered the opportunity to consent for the Multicentre, Double-blind, Randomized, Placebo Controlled, Parallel Group, Phase 3, Safety Extension Study to Evaluate the Safety and Tolerability of Tezepelumab in Adults and Adolescents with Severe Uncontrolled Asthma. The study consists of a treatment phase, followed by a follow-up phase where subjects will not receive IP. The length of the follow up phase is determined by which study the subject had previously completed.

Primary Outcome

Includes adverse events with an onset date between the date of first dose of IP in the predecessor and minimum (date of last dose of IP + 33 days, date of death, date of study withdrawal, day prior to start of another biologic). The analysis is based on the Safety Analysis Set. Exposure adjusted rates are defined as number of subjects with AEs divided by total time at risk across all subjects, multiplied by 100
